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ators salary by percentile in Alabama
BLS-reported salary distribution — from entry-level (10th percentile) to top earners (90th percentile).
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ators in Alabama earn a median salary of $29,850 per year ($2,487/month).
This is 24.2% below the national average of $39,396.
Alabama ranks #27 out of 29 states for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ators pay.
Approximately 40 people work in this occupation across Alabama.
Salaries increased by 3.3% compared to 2024.
About This Job: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ators
Perform work involved in developing and processing photographic images from film or digital media. May perform precision tasks such as editing photographic negatives and prints.

Salary Range: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ators in Alabama
Salaries for Photographic Process Workers and Processing Machine Operators in Alabama range from $27,510 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$46,090 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$28,190 and $39,420.

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2025 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.
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
